Method for increasing HDL cholesterol levels using heteroaromatic phenylmethanes

An HDL cholesterol level inducing compound and a method of administering the compound having the structural formula I. ##STR1## wherein n is 1 or 2;R1 is a heteroaromatic substituent independently selected from a five-membered heteroaromatic ring having at least one N heteroatom, a six-membered heteroaromatic ring having at least one N heteroatom, or a fused ring system having at least one five-membered heteroaromatic ring having at least one N heteroatom;R2 is independently selected from --H or phenyl; andR3 is independently selected from --H, --CH3, --OH, phenyl, phenyl substituted with Cl, OCH3, CH3, or F, fused phenyl ring system, or six-membered heteroaromatic ring having at least one N heteroatom.
